Want a confidence boost to explore new places? Memories of how to use a map and compass faded?
Join us to visit a Dartmoor that's off the beaten track, and a day to help regain your confidence to visit places you've never been to before. Providing a reminder of how to use a map and compass as well as an opportunity to to discover other ways to feel your way through the landscape e.g.: natural navigation (feeling and seeing the landscape). Experience how to always know where you are and how to get to where you'd like to be, whatever the weather.
You'll be walking with others of similar ability and led by Verran Townsend, qualified walking guide and navigator who along with 'Dartmoor's Daughter', loves to encourage and enable others to experience the wildness and beauty of Dartmoor.

Level: 3 out of 5. The walk is gentle with a relaxed pace and many stops to practice navigation techniques and to have lunch, but you need to be happy spending approximately 3 hours in hilly moorland terrain.

Meeting point: Car park at Hemsworthy Gate (this is a small carpark on the junction) about 20 minutes drive from the Ashburton turn-off on the A38. Grid reference for the car park is SX 742761 . Nearest postcode is TQ13 9XT for the Haytor Visitors Centre but this will not get you to the exact location. Car sharing is recommended.
What to bring: Map (OL28 Ordnance Survey map of Dartmoor), compass, lunch, drink, sunscreen, warm layers, hat, gloves, waterproof clothing (even if the forecast is fine!) and sturdy walking boots.
For advice on compasses, Silva is recommended and a good source is, for example, Dash4it.co.uk www.dash4it.co.uk/accessories/accessory-type/compasses.html Any of the following would be fine: Silva Starter 8; Silva Field; Silva Ranger; Silva Expedition 4.
